WHAT IS AN advertising agency remote jobs

Advertising Agency Remote Jobs refer to work opportunities in advertising agencies that allow professionals to work from remote locations, such as their homes or co-working spaces, rather than commuting to a physical office. Remote jobs have become increasingly popular in recent years, as technology has made it easier to communicate and collaborate with team members from anywhere in the world. Advertising agencies have embraced remote work as a way to attract top talent regardless of their location and to improve work-life balance for their employees.

WHAT USUALLY DO IN THIS POSITION

Remote jobs in advertising agencies can encompass a wide range of roles, from creative to administrative to technical. Some common positions include: - Account Manager: responsible for managing client relationships, ensuring projects are delivered on time and on budget, and overseeing project teams. - Creative Director: responsible for leading the creative vision for a project, managing a team of designers and copywriters, and ensuring the final product meets the client's objectives. - Copywriter: responsible for creating written content for various advertising campaigns, such as ads, social media posts, and email marketing. - Graphic Designer: responsible for creating visual content for various advertising campaigns, such as logos, ads, and website design. - Digital Marketer: responsible for developing and executing digital marketing campaigns, such as email marketing, social media advertising, and search engine optimization.

TOP 5 SKILLS FOR POSITION

The skills required for remote jobs in advertising agencies can vary depending on the specific role, but some common skills include:
  • Creative thinking: the ability to develop innovative ideas and solutions that meet the client's objectives.
  • Communication: the ability to effectively communicate with team members, clients, and other stakeholders in a remote setting.
  • Time management: the ability to manage multiple projects and deadlines in a fast-paced environment.
  • Technical proficiency: the ability to use various software and tools required for the role, such as Adobe Creative Suite, Google Analytics, or project management software.
  • Collaboration: the ability to work effectively with team members in a remote setting, including giving and receiving feedback and contributing to brainstorming sessions.

HOW TO BECOME THIS TYPE OF SPECIALIST

To become a remote specialist in advertising agencies, you will typically need a combination of education, experience, and skills. Most positions require a bachelor's degree in a relevant field, such as marketing, advertising, or graphic design. However, many employers value experience and skills over formal education, so it's essential to gain hands-on experience through internships or freelance work. To improve your chances of landing a remote job in an advertising agency, you should also focus on developing the skills required for the specific role you're interested in. For example, if you want to become a copywriter, you should focus on developing excellent writing skills, while if you want to become a digital marketer, you should focus on learning about the latest trends and techniques in digital marketing.

AVERAGE SALARY

The average salary for remote jobs in advertising agencies can vary depending on the specific role, location, and level of experience. According to Glassdoor, the average salary for remote Account Managers in the United States is $73,000 per year, while the average salary for remote Creative Directors is $111,000 per year. Remote Copywriters can expect to earn an average of $57,000 per year, while remote Graphic Designers can earn an average of $52,000 per year.

WHAT ARE THE TYPICAL TOOLS

Remote jobs in advertising agencies typically require the use of various software and tools to collaborate and communicate with team members and clients. Some of the most common tools used in these roles include: - Project management software: tools like Trello, Asana, and Basecamp are used to manage projects, assign tasks, and track progress. - Communication tools: tools like Slack, Zoom, and Skype are used to communicate with team members and clients in real-time. - Design software: tools like Adobe Creative Suite and Sketch are used to create and edit visual content for advertising campaigns. - Marketing automation software: tools like HubSpot, Marketo, and Pardot are used to automate various aspects of digital marketing campaigns, such as email marketing and social media advertising.
